Output 50518395ee67201ade463d493471b3d3ee49231addce65e16a2de54bb36ef002:0

value
380679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2acc772c5c21d762e72234134de5b96204682fa OP_EQUALVERIFY OP_CHECKSIG
address
1P89WKr7fDZnqbQDo6cYG2ze3p8TsUyoW9
transaction
50518395ee67201ade463d493471b3d3ee49231addce65e16a2de54bb36ef002
confirmations
253706
spent
true